Starcraft Marine C-Star 170 DC 2004 vs Starcraft Marine FD 161 Cruise 2007 — Same Brand, Different Boat
The Starcraft Marine C-Star 170 DC 2004 vs Starcraft Marine FD 161 Cruise 2007 comparison sits squarely in the category of decisions where specs alone won't tell the whole story — intended use, storage, and long-term ownership costs all factor in.
Both boats share a closely matched power ceiling — 125 hp for the Starcraft Marine C-Star 170 DC 2004 and 115 hp for the Starcraft Marine FD 161 Cruise 2007. Real-world performance will come down more to which motor is actually bolted on, its load at the time, and whether it's a 4-stroke or 2-stroke setup. Both carry nearly identical fuel loads — 32 gal and 31 gal — so range won't be a tiebreaker here.
For family outings this is probably the sharpest distinction between the two. The Starcraft Marine FD 161 Cruise 2007 is rated for 9 passengers, while the Starcraft Marine C-Star 170 DC 2004 caps at 6. If you're regularly pulling extended family or a group of friends onto the water, the extra seats on the Starcraft Marine FD 161 Cruise 2007 could be the deciding factor.
Bottom line: Choose the Starcraft Marine FD 161 Cruise 2007 if your priority is putting more people on the water — it handles 9 passengers and at 15,0 ft it has the deck room to back that rating up comfortably. The Starcraft Marine C-Star 170 DC 2004 is the smarter pick if you want a lighter, easier-to-trailer boat rated for 6 that costs less to run day-to-day.
